Abstract: (arXiv)
We calculate filling factors () and ionized masses (M) for a total of 84 galactic and extragalactic planetary nebulae (PNe) at known distances. To do these calculations, we have chosen forbidden line electron densities, observed angular diameters, and H fluxes, from the most recent measurements available in the literature. Statistical analysis on the distributions of and show that (1) the ranges of values of these parameters is wider than what was previously found: (2) the mean value of the filling factor is between and , for the different sets: (3) the mean value of the ionized mass is between and : (4) a clear correlation between the filling factors and the dimensions of the PNe was not found when distance-independent sets of PNe were used: (5) for extragalactic PNe, where distance errors are not a factor, the filling factors and the ionized masses anticorrelate tightly with the electron densities. The results indicate that the modified Shklowsky distance method is correct.References(1)
